Sterling Silver Jewellery FAQs
Sterling silver is a metal alloy made of pure silver mixed with other metals, usually copper or zinc. We combine pure silver with these metals to make it more durable for use in jewellery making. Many of our silver jewellery pieces use sterling silver, including our earrings, studs and fine chain necklaces, because it has a bright and shiny finish, and tends to be comfortable for most people to wear on a daily basis. Sterling silver jewellery can naturally tarnish over time when in it comes into contact with moisture or oxygen. To prevent tarnishing and keep your jewellery in good condition, polish with a soft lint-free cloth and store in a protective jewellery box or cloth bag. We also recommend removing your jewellery before showering or bathing to keep your jewellery looking its best. For more information, read our guide on how to prevent your jewellery from tarnishing.
The best way to remove dullness from your silver jewellery pieces is to give them a regular buff using a soft, non-abrasive lint-free cloth to polish the metal without scratching the surface. For more advice from 78zin's Jewellery Team, read our guide on how to clean silver jewellery.
